The Challenge
Large-scale steel manufacturing depends on efficient maintenance management to ensure maximum equipment availability, production continuity, operational safety, and cost control. As production demands increased, Jindal Steel identified the need to strengthen maintenance planning capabilities and standardize maintenance budgeting practices across its engineering and maintenance teams.
The organization aimed to:
- Improve maintenance planning and scheduling across manufacturing units.
- Standardize maintenance budgeting and maintenance cost control processes.
- Optimize CAPEX and OPEX decision-making for plant maintenance.
- Enhance annual shutdown planning and maintenance execution.
- Improve manpower planning and maintenance resource utilization.
- Strengthen spare parts forecasting and inventory optimization.
- Build KPI-driven maintenance performance management practices.
- Foster a proactive maintenance culture focused on operational excellence.
- Enhance vendor management and Annual Maintenance Contract (AMC) governance.

About Jindal Steel
Jindal Steel is one of India's leading integrated steel manufacturers, delivering high-quality steel products to infrastructure, automotive, engineering, construction, energy, and industrial sectors. With advanced manufacturing facilities and a strong focus on operational excellence, digital transformation, and sustainable manufacturing, the company continuously invests in employee capability development to improve plant performance, equipment reliability, maintenance efficiency, and long-term business growth.
